logo

Output e31c9c0c475d6d13248348f22c5e2604be11f7c6435adb7b5b5fcf4b88a06aa1:1

value
61150868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 614ef80d58a409328795fc8618d7366d9388c36c OP_EQUAL
address
3AZY51ZDrgy5CvYdLErZj33ZomCiWiUP21
transaction
e31c9c0c475d6d13248348f22c5e2604be11f7c6435adb7b5b5fcf4b88a06aa1